Phase 1/2 Study of MRTX849 in Patients With Cancer Having a KRAS G12C Mutation KRYSTAL-1
Sponsor: Mirati Therapeutics Inc.
ClinicalTrials ID:NCT03785249
This Phase 1/2 study assesses the safety, tolerability, pharmacokinetics, and clinical activity of MRTX849 in patients with advanced solid tumors with a KRAS G12C mutation. Eligible patients have unresectable or metastatic disease. Interventions include oral MRTX849, intravenous pembrolizumab and cetuximab, and oral afatinib, depending on cohort assignment.

Description
This study will evaluate the safety, tolerability, pharmacokinetics, metabolites, pharmacodynamics, and clinical activity of MRTX849 (adagrasib) in patients with advanced solid tumors with a KRAS G12C mutation. MRTX849 (adagrasib) is an orally-available small molecule inhibitor of KRAS G12C.
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- Histologically confirmed diagnosis of a solid tumor malignancy with KRAS G12C mutation
- Unresectable or metastatic disease
- Standard treatment is not available or patient declines; first-line treatment for NSCLC for certain cohorts
- Adequate organ function
Exclusion Criteria
- History of intestinal disease or major gastric surgery or inability to swallow oral medications
- Other active cancer
